Letterpress Lab

Our weekly Letterpress Lab introduces the process and materials for printing by hand with wood type on a selection of antique printing presses, including a Vandercook cylinder proof press.

We'll show you the basics and help get you started on projects, and together, explore more advanced printing techniques with special guests.

No experience necessary.

All supplies provided. 

Note: This program may involve direct handling of lead-based type and is not suitable for small children.

Bob Ross Birthday Paint-Along

October 29th is Bob Ross's birthday. Paint a happy little fall scene and celebrate the birthday of everyone's favorite permed public television art instructor. All supplies are provided, although participants may want to bring an apron or old t-shirt for painting.

Sustainable Printing in the Age of the Anthropocene

Olivia Arau-McSweeney, artist and student at the Penny Stamps School of Art and Design at U–M, discusses and demonstrates non-toxic and sustainable techniques for printmaking and analog photography.

This event is in partnership with the Penny Stamps School of Art and Design at the University of Michigan. Olivia Arau-McSweeney's art will be on view as part of the 2019 Stamps Senior Show from April 12th-May 4th at the Stamps Gallery (201 Division St.)
